
Bernardine Church and Monastery is the largest functioning Catholic complex in Grodno. The temple is one of the oldest in Belarus. The history of the construction of the complex began in the late 15th century. The temple is a mixture of Gothic, Renaissance and Baroque styles.
A unique organ of the 17th century has been preserved in the church, creating a unique atmosphere with its sound. Among the special values of the church are 12 sculptures of the apostles and 14 altars.
